Average Cost of Solar Panels in Oak Park
Let's take a look at the average cost of solar panels in Oak Park.
Currently, the national average cost of solar panels is $2.66 per watt. However, in Oak Park, the average cost of a solar system is 2.73 per watt. The average solar panel system size in Oak Park is around 2.9 kilowatts, meaning a cost of about $5,465 for a solar installation, or $7,815 before the 30% federal solar tax credit is applied.
Keep in mind that the figures above are only estimates based on the average energy use of Oak Park homeowners. The price of a solar system for your home may look different depending on factors unique to you, like your household energy use and solar contractor. But, after you've paid the upfront cost of installation, the ROI for most homeowners is quite rewarding, with a net average savings of about $25,000 over 20 years on utility bills.

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Oak Park
There are many criteria that can influence your solar system installation cost, such as the size of your system, the equipment you choose, your financing options and the specific company that installs your solar system.
Solar Equipment
System size, which is measured in kilowatts, is one of the largest factors that influences the overall cost of installing solar panels. Because of that, it's a priority to accurately assess the size of the solar energy system needed for your home by figuring out your typical energy use. The type of solar panels and equipment you choose is another factor that will greatly affect costs. Solar panels that have higher efficiency, like monocrystalline panels, tend to come at a higher price. Plus, solar equipment goes beyond just the solar panels themselves. You'll also need to consider the kind of racks used to mount the panels, inverters, solar batteries, etc. It's important to take all of this into consideration when searching for a solar system that falls within your budget.
Solar Financing Terms
Most solar companies in Oak Park have solar loans, which reduce the initial cost of installing solar. However, the interest on solar loans also increases your all-in costs, so it's crucial to keep that in mind as well. You can always lower the total you pay in interest and sometimes even your APR by putting more money down.
Solar Panel Installation Company
A final factor to consider when trying to evaluate the cost of solar for your home or business in Oak Park is the company you hire to install your solar panel system. As with choosing a company to renovate your kitchen, for example, there's no shortage of solar installers that provide a range of services at different price points. Additionally, some companies in Oak Park know more about local solar incentives and can help you learn about additional rebates or tax exemptions. However, they may charge more for that service. Even if they cost more upfront, they could end up saving you more money in the long run.
Solar Panel Cost Data by System Size
System size | Cost per system watt | Solar system cost | 25-Year savings | Payback period |
---|---|---|---|---|
6 kW | $2.84 | $11,925 | $27,391 | 7.6 years |
8 kW | $2.78 | $15,594 | $36,827 | 7.4 years |
10 kW | $2.73 | $19,110 | $46,416 | 7.3 years |
12 kW | $2.68 | $22,473 | $56,157 | 7.1 years |
14 kW | $2.62 | $25,684 | $66,052 | 7.0 years |
16 kW | $2.57 | $28,741 | $76,100 | 6.9 years |
18 kW | $2.51 | $31,646 | $86,300 | 6.7 years |
20 kW | $2.46 | $34,398 | $96,653 | 6.6 years |
How to Save on Solar Panels
There are a lot of companies available in Oak Park, and some homeowners feel overwhelmed considering their options. Selecting the right company for you can be difficult, so here are some tips to help you decide:
- Contract: When reading through your solar installer's contract, ask for clarification about any terms you're not sure of and be sure you understand what happens in scenarios like a system part breaking or if the company goes out of business.
- Solar Panel Brands: Not all solar companies have the same brands of solar panels, so the brand and type of panel you want can play a large role in the company you choose.
- Reputation: Make sure your solar system installer has a good reputation by confirming it has certifications and licenses, checking how long it's been in business and reading reviews by previous customers and solar experts like the EcoWatch team.
- Warranty: An all-inclusive, long-term warranty can help keep your solar panels running for years to come and save you money on repairs and maintenance.

What other factors should I consider other than cost when buying solar panels?
The upfront cost is a key factor to consider, but whether it's the most important for you depends on why you decided to go solar. In cities where rooftop space is limited, efficiency can be more important than the cost. Other factors that are important to be mindful of are the quality and durability of your solar panels.
Do solar panels increase your property value?
Solar panels can increase the value of your home significantly as long as you buy or finance your panels and don't go for a solar lease or power purchase agreement (PPA). According to research done by Zillow, the average home value increases by about 4.1% after installing solar panels."
How many solar panels do I need to power my home?
The exact number of solar panels you need depends on your household energy consumption and the amount of sunlight your roof gets. You can look at your energy bills for the past year to get an idea of the solar system size you'll need. The average household has to buy between 20 and 35 panels to cover their typical energy usage.
